The Sheridan County Commissioners met in regular session at 9:15 A.M. in the Commissioners Office, Courthouse. All members present. Paul stated that the meeting would be conducted in accordance with the provisions of the Nebraska Open Meeting Act. 

Messersmith made a motion to accept the agenda. Krotz seconded the motion. All voted aye. 

Messersmith made a motion to approve the minutes of 10-28-2019. Krotz seconded the motion. All voted aye. 

The board audited and approved claims. General-$67,032.91; Road-$25,787.90; Inheritance-$12,500.00; Wireless 911- $793.89; Insurance-$14,83.21; Weed-$264.03; E-911- $1,593.83; Handi-Bus $2,485.00 Total of $111,940.77. 

Road Superintendent Tom Kuester met with the board to review the bids for a loader. Larry Burbach from NMC and Mike Bateman from John Deere were present to field any questions that the board or Kuester had. Krotz made a motion to purchase the 624L John Deere loader with a rear camera, LED lights and the 3.75 bucket for $190,000 from Murphy Tractor. Messersmith seconded the motion. With a roll call vote all voted aye. 

The board reviewed a couple of subdivision of land requests. No action taken. They will be revisited when surveys are done. Building Superintendent Jeff Davis informed the board that the replacement of the courthouse roof has been completed.
